### Step 4: Fuel Report Service

Migrate the Wexhall fleet fuel-usage report before decommissioning the old scheduler. The service now pulls odometer and pump data from the Cartwheel warehouse instead of nightly CSV drops. Verify the staging run completes once end-to-end, then apply the production configuration shown below.

deployment values, kajep-kageg:
[praix]
host = praix.paliqcorp.corp
user = praix_svc
database = praix_prod

The VramScope profiler exposes a REST endpoint for pulling per-kernel GPU memory snapshots, which is honestly the fastest way to spot fragmentation before it bites you in a long training run. Hit `/v2/snapshots` with a POST and you'll get back allocation timelines grouped by stream. Every call needs authentication against the Gridfall metrics gateway — no anonymous reads, even internally, since snapshots can leak model architecture details. For sandbox experiments, the team keeps a shared key you can drop straight into your config.

service key, tadup-tahog: zpat7_wB1tnEL

**Migration Step 3: StormFan fan-out service**

Welcome, newcomers! This step moves StormFan — our weather-alert fan-out that pushes severe-weather notices to subscriber channels — off the old Quillby queue onto the new Drammen bus. Pause the publisher first, or alerts will double-send (ask anyone about the hailstorm incident). Once paused, point the consumers at the new bus using the settings below.

service settings:
[casax]
port = 6379
team = rusir
host = casax.zemvarhq.corp
region = outer-4
access_code = ac_9808ce
timeout_ms = 1500

Onboarding note for the Ledgerpane admin table: bulk edits are applied through the batcher service, not directly against the database. Select rows, choose an action, and the batcher stages changes in a pending set you can review before commit. Edits over 500 rows require a second approver — this is enforced server-side, so don't try to chunk around it. To run the batcher locally you need the staging write credential, which goes in your .env as the next line.

secret setting of bahip-kagag: RELAY_SECRET3=c83